To find the inverse of a function, first use x and y as dependent and independent variables.
\n" ); document.write( "\"f%28x%29=x%5E5\"
\n" ); document.write( "\"y=x%5E5\"
\n" ); document.write( "Now interchange x and y and solve for y.
\n" ); document.write( "\"y=x%5E5\"
\n" ); document.write( "\"highlight%28x%29=highlight%28y%29%5E5\"
\n" ); document.write( "\"y=x%5E%281%2F5%29\"
\n" ); document.write( "\"f%5E%28-1%29%28x%29=x%5E%281%2F5%29\"
\n" ); document.write( "The answer's a bit cut off but the exponent should be (1/5).
